Accueil > Forum > > > > Création et téléchargement d'un fichier Excel
Création et téléchargement d'un fichier Excel
mercredi 31 mars 2004 à 19:46:37 |
Création et téléchargement d'un fichier Excel

logarfr
|
Pour une application en servlet, j'ai besoin de générer un fichier excel en temporaire à partir d'un tableau HTML (ou autre chose) et ensuite de le proposer en téléchargement au client. Je ne sais pas du tout comment faire et comment m'y prendre. D'après ce que j'ai vu, il existe des librairies spécifiques pour faire ça mais sont-elles vraiment nécessaire? Je vous remercie d'avance!
|
|
mercredi 31 mars 2004 à 20:40:16 |
Re : Création et téléchargement d'un fichier Excel

neodante
|
 Neodante  Si c'est du Excel avec le format XML c'est faisable sinon tu remercieras MS d'avoir des formats de fichier fermés ! Mais en passant par des filtres tout comme OpenOffice tu pourrais te débrouiller, mais bonne chance ! @+ [Responsable www.neogamedev.com]
|
|
mercredi 31 mars 2004 à 23:29:40 |
Re : Création et téléchargement d'un fichier Excel

logarfr
|
merci je vais m'orienter vers ta solution.
Si je comprends bien, il faut que je génère un fichier XML et à a partir de celui ci, il faut que je le transforme en XML via XSL, ... ?
c'est bien ca ?
|
|
jeudi 1 avril 2004 à 09:13:04 |
Re : Création et téléchargement d'un fichier Excel

neodante
|
 Neodante  Si tu as Office System et que tu peux générer des XML alors c'est bon à condition que ton utilisateur finale ait Office System également ... sinon tu vas devoir générer du XML avec les spécifications MS que tu trouveras sur leur site ... c pas compliqué ... et puis faire un script ou autre (appli .NET en 3 minutes) qui t'ouvre Excel avec ton fichier XML puis te l'enregistre en .xls ... m'enfin bon solution galère dans tous les cas ... C'est vrai que XML puis XSLT est beaucoup plus simple ! regarde les filtres de OpebOffice tu devrai spouvoir t'en sortir ... @+ [Responsable www.neogamedev.com]
|
|
jeudi 1 avril 2004 à 09:47:18 |
Re : Création et téléchargement d'un fichier Excel

logarfr
|
Merci mais j'ai trouvé un autre moyen 100x plus facile, c'est un peut bateau mais ca marche.
Il suffit de créer un fichier normal et de le nomé en ".xls". Pour passer d'une cellule à l'autre il suffit de faire des tabulation et voila c'est fini!
Je remerci NEODANTE pour ses conseil!
Bonne programmetion à tous
|
|
jeudi 1 avril 2004 à 13:11:04 |
Re : Création et téléchargement d'un fichier Excel
|
mercredi 6 octobre 2004 à 17:58:40 |
Re : Création et téléchargement d'un fichier Excel

elchoupi
|
La solution xml est trés bonne, mais ne fonctionne que pour des version d'XL > XL 2000, genre XL XP. Pour utiliser de la surcharge de couleur ou de style sur le texte et des bordures, tu peux utiliser le format sylk, un peu difficile d'emploie mais complétement compatible. Si tu veux en plus avoir des fonds de couleurs dans tes cases, tu peux utiliser bétement le format html (renommé en xls). Mais tu n'auras pas la main sur la largeur de tes colonnes.
|
|
mercredi 6 octobre 2004 à 18:03:05 |
Re : Création et téléchargement d'un fichier Excel

elchoupi
|
Au passage, voici un petit mémo que je m'étais fait pour le format sylk. En espérant qu'il soit clair pour quelqu'un :
Création d?un fichier SYLK (.slk)
1. Entête
Invariablement ID;PWXL;N;E
2. Paramètres
L?espace de paramétrage débute par P;PGeneral
Il est suivit de 4 linges obligatoires
P;FArial;M200 P;FArial;M200 P;FArial;M200 P;FArial;M200
La première de ces lignes permet de définir l?aspect des titres de lignes et de colonnes. Après F on donne le nom de la police. Après M la taille (200 = 12pt, 160 = 8pt).
On peut ensuite mettre les paramètres personnalisés, par exemple
P;ECourier New;M160;L31 P;EArial;M160;SBIU;L30
Après L on a le code couleur. Après S B pour gras, I pour italique et U pour souligné.
3. Corps
Cas le plus simple C;Y1;X1;K"truc"
Cas avec choix du 5e paramètre F;SM5;Y1;X1 C;K"truc"
Cas avec choix du 6e paramètre et centré F;FG0C;SM6;Y1;X2 C;K"machin"
Cas avec choix du 6e paramètre et encadré F;SLRTBM6;Y1;X3 C;K"chose"
Après Y le numéro de ligne. Après X le numéro de colonne. Après K la valeur de la case. FG0 C pour centré, L pour aligné à gauche et R pour aligner à droite. Après S M+Chiffre pour le choix du paramètre, L pour bord gauche, R pour bord droit, T pour bord hauts, B pour bord bas.
4. Fin
Le fichier est terminé par E
5. Exemple
ID;PWXL;N;E P;PGeneral P;FArial;M200 P;FArial;M200 P;FArial;M200 P;FArial;M200 P;ECourier New;M160;L31 P;EArial;M160;SBIU;L30 F;SM5;Y1;X1 C;K"truc" F;FG0C;SM6;Y1;X2 C;K"machin" F;SLRTBM6;Y1;X3 C;K"chose" E
|
|
Cette discussion est classée dans : fichier, excel, téléchargement, création
Répondre à ce message
Sujets en rapport avec ce message
Création d'un fichier html [ par chleuh ]
Salut tout le monde j'ai un p'ti souci:En fait le but du jeu c'est de récupérér dans un fichier txt des données puis de générer un fichier html avec c
Barre de progression pour Téléchargement [ par MdcPhoenix ]
Bonjour à tous, je vous présente mon problème.Je voudrai savoir comment afficher la progression d'un téléchargement client / serveur grâce à des socke
[thread] Aide sur la création [ par Letanguy ]
Bonjour !j'ai une application en java qui lorsque l'on clique sur un bouton télécharge un fichier. Le problème c'est que lorsque le programme téléchar
transférer le contenu d une jtable en fichier excel [ par acoutarel ]
Je voudrais savoir comment transférer le contenu d une jtable en fichier excel puis sans reservir pour pouvoi innitialiser une jtable merciKin'gyo
Ouverture fichier EXCEL [ par Tara ]
Salut !J'aimerais savoir s'il est possible d'ouvrir un fichier EXCEL à partir d'une IHM en java, le fichier à ouvrir étant sélectionné grâce à la boît
Imprimer un fichier Excel [ par dwinkel ]
Bonjour,Je cherche tout simplement à imprimer un fichier Excel en Java.Toutes les solutions sont les bienvenues (ligne de commande ms-dos, programme j
JAVA XML EXCEL [ par bvitalis ]
Salut,j'ai besoin de créer un fichier EXCEL depuis un fichier XML si possible en Java.Existe-t-il une APi qui le permette ? Est-ce quelqu'un a déjà ét
Zip, servlet, et fichier Excel [ par as634 ]
J'ai créé un fichier excel grace à jExcel. Je voudrais insérer ce fichier dans une archive zip qui sera renvoyée par ma servlet.Voici mon code pour la
HttpServlet -> envoie de fichier excel (générer avec POI) [ par Thundrax ]
Hello, je revien encore et tjrs avec mes kestions.Je rappel juste la situation, je suis sur un portail (uPortal)Alors je génère un fichier excel avec
creation de fichier excel [ par Xiotos ]
Je dois créer des fichiers excel avec jbuilder mais ceux ci se trouvent avec une mise en page "paysage". Quelqu'un pourrais m'aider à découvrir la sub
Livres en rapport
|
Derniers Blogs
L'INTERFACE NATURELLE DE WINDOWS PHONE 7 SERIESL'INTERFACE NATURELLE DE WINDOWS PHONE 7 SERIES par odewit
La tendance est aux interfaces naturelles (NUI), et le keynote de Bill Buxton au MIX l'a bien souligné.
La charte graphique et ergonomique de Windows Phone 7 a donc été entièrement repensée en vue d'obtenir un maximum d'efficacité sur ce point. En re...
Cliquez pour lire la suite de l'article par odewit COMMENT MAPPER UNE VUE SQL SUR UNE COLLECTION DE COMPLEX TYPE?COMMENT MAPPER UNE VUE SQL SUR UNE COLLECTION DE COMPLEX TYPE? par Matthieu MEZIL
Avec EF, les vues doivent être mappées sur des entity types. Le problème c'est que les entity types doivent avoir une clé. Avec EF, nous avons les complex type qui n'ont pas de clé mais les vues ne peuvent pas être mappées dessus. Avec EF4, il est possibl...
Cliquez pour lire la suite de l'article par Matthieu MEZIL [WF4] UN BINDING ACTIVITY/ACTIVITYDESIGNER QUI PASSE MAL?[WF4] UN BINDING ACTIVITY/ACTIVITYDESIGNER QUI PASSE MAL? par JeremyJeanson
Certain d'entre vous on peut être vécu cette situation embarrassante après quelques temps passer avec WF4 : Au début avec mon " ActivityDesigner" , tout allait bien. Et puis un jour j'ai au des problèmes de " Binding" . Alors nous sommes allé sur le site ...
Cliquez pour lire la suite de l'article par JeremyJeanson
Logiciels
Academy System (10.9.4.0)ACADEMY SYSTEM (10.9.4.0)Logiciel de gestion des établissements.
- élèves/étudiants (inscription, dossier, absence...)
-... Cliquez pour télécharger Academy System Xilisoft Convertisseur Vidéo Ultimate (5.1.39.0305)XILISOFT CONVERTISSEUR VIDéO ULTIMATE (5.1.39.0305)Xilisoft Convertisseur Vidéo Ultimate est un outil puissant de conversion vidéo, facile à utilise... Cliquez pour télécharger Xilisoft Convertisseur Vidéo Ultimate Xilisoft DVD Ripper Ultimate (5.0.64.0304)XILISOFT DVD RIPPER ULTIMATE (5.0.64.0304)Xilisoft DVD Ripper Ultimate est un logiciel excellent pour copier et convertir DVD vers presque ... Cliquez pour télécharger Xilisoft DVD Ripper Ultimate Rigs of Rods (63.3)RIGS OF RODS (63.3)c'est un jeu de multi-simulation camions,autobus voitures, avions, bateaux, hélicoptère avec défo... Cliquez pour télécharger Rigs of Rods
|